How much is the rebate for solar panels in Duval, NSW

The Australian Federal Government has incentives for Duval homeowners to install solar. They give "STCs" (small-scale technology certificates) to people who add a solar power system to their home.

The government divides the country into "Zones" depending on the rated solar potential. You get more support or less depending on your zone. Duval is in Climate Zone 3 which has a rating of 1.382.

This means a 10 kW solar system installed in Duval during 2024 would give you 96 ST Certificates worth $3830.40 (at an STC price of $39.90 each).

If you wait until 2025 for your panels the rebate in Duval will be reduced. It goes down every year.

Here's about how much Solar Energy falls on Duval by month. The maximum is 7.12 kWh/M2 in January. The minimum is 3.00 kWh/M2 during June.

Daily Energy Per Square Metre in Duval
MonthEnergy MJ/M2kWh/M2
Jan25.647.12
Feb22.796.33
Mar20.095.58
Apr16.244.51
May12.783.55
Jun10.793.00
Jul11.783.27
Aug15.124.20
Sep18.985.27
Oct22.236.18
Nov24.066.68
Dec25.487.08

Figures from the weather station at Inverell, which is approximately 90.7 km from Duval.

Duval, NSW is in the 2350 postcode area which has around 3085 solar installations under 10 kW and about 3335 total installations including large scale solar. As a comparison there are roughly 148143 small solar installations in greater Brisbane.

With an estimated 11333 households in the 2350 area that gives a small solar installation (average size around 4.32 kW) for about every 3.7 dwellings.

Solar Panel Angle in Duval

It is generally recommended to angle your panels at about 30.4° from the horizontal in this area - facing north, although your power usage patterns could alter this - if you are out all day.
